Condicionales en JavaScript: Introducción a su Uso y Propósito
Los condicionales en JavaScript, al igual que en otros lenguajes de programación, son una herramienta fundamental para controlar el flujo de un programa. Estas estructuras nos permiten tomar decisiones basadas en ciertas condiciones, y en función de si se cumplen o no, ejecutar diferentes acciones.
Por ejemplo, imagina que estás desarrollando una aplicación web y quieres mostrar un mensaje de bienvenida solo a los usuarios registrados. Un condicional te permitiría verificar si el usuario está registrado y, en función de eso, decidir si mostrar o no el mensaje.
¿Qué son los condicionales en JavaScript?
En esencia, un condicional en JavaScript evalúa una expresión y, dependiendo de si el resultado es verdadero o falso, ejecuta un bloque de código u otro. Esta capacidad de "tomar decisiones" hace que los condicionales sean esenciales para cualquier programa, ya que nos permiten adaptar nuestro código a diferentes situaciones.
Tipos de condicionales en JavaScript
Existen varios tipos de condicionales en JavaScript, cada uno con su propósito y características:
- Condicional If: Ejecuta un bloque de código si se cumple una condición.
- If-else: Ejecuta un bloque de código si se cumple una condición y otro si no se cumple.
- Switch: Evalúa una expresión y ejecuta diferentes bloques de código según el resultado.
Importancia de los condicionales
Al igual que con cualquier herramienta en programación, es esencial comprender cuándo y cómo usar los condicionales adecuadamente. A medida que te familiarices con JavaScript y enfrentes diferentes desafíos de programación, te darás cuenta de la versatilidad y potencia de los condicionales.
Conclusión
En resumen, los condicionales en JavaScript son una herramienta esencial que nos permite controlar el flujo de nuestro programa y adaptar nuestro código a diferentes situaciones. Ya sea que estés comenzando tu viaje en la programación o seas un desarrollador experimentado, los condicionales serán tus aliados constantes en la creación de aplicaciones dinámicas y reactivas.
Si te interesa profundizar más en los condicionales y aprender sobre cada tipo en detalle, te invito a continuar explorando y practicando con ejemplos concretos. Y, como siempre, si tienes dudas o comentarios, no dudes en compartirlos.
La última actualización de este artículo fue hace 1 año